Hàm FormatCurrency trong VBScript

Định nghĩa và cách sử dụng

Hàm FormatCurrency có thể trả về biểu thức được định dạng thành giá trị tiền tệ, sử dụng biểu tượng tiền tệ được định nghĩa trong bảng điều khiển hệ thống.

Ngữ pháp

FormatCurrency(Expression[,NumDigAfterDec[,
IncLeadingDig[,UseParForNegNum[,GroupDig]]]])
Tham số Mô tả
expression Bắt buộc. Cần được định dạng biểu thức.
NumDigAfterDec Chỉ ra số số sau dấu chấm của số thập phân được hiển thị. Giá trị mặc định là -1 (sử dụng thiết lập vùng máy tính).
IncLeadingDig Tùy chọn. Chỉ ra liệu có hiển thị số lẻ số không đầu tiên (leading zero) của số thập phân hay không:
  • -2 = TristateUseDefault - Sử dụng thiết lập vùng máy tính của máy tính.
  • -1 = TristateTrue - True
  • 0 = TristateFalse - False
UseParForNegNum Tùy chọn. Chỉ ra liệu có đặt giá trị âm trong dấu ngoặc hay không.
  • -2 = TristateUseDefault - Sử dụng thiết lập vùng máy tính của máy tính.
  • -1 = TristateTrue - True
  • 0 = TristateFalse - False
GroupDig Tùy chọn. Chỉ ra liệu có sử dụng dấu chấm phẩy để nhóm số trong thiết lập vùng máy tính của máy tính hay không.
  • -2 = TristateUseDefault - Sử dụng thiết lập vùng máy tính của máy tính.
  • -1 = TristateTrue - True
  • 0 = TristateFalse - False

Mẫu

Ví dụ 1

document.write(FormatCurrency(20000))

Kết quả đầu ra:

¥20,000.00

Ví dụ 2

document.write(FormatCurrency(20000.578,2))

Kết quả đầu ra:

¥20,000.58

Ví dụ 3

document.write(FormatCurrency(20000.578,2,,,0))

Kết quả đầu ra:

¥20000.58